Apple einkorn cake provides 312 calories per 100 g. The same serving contains 49.6 g of carbohydrates, 5.8 g of protein, and 10.4 g of fat.
Apple einkorn cake is listed as compatible with Mediterranean, vegetarian, flexitarian, and omnivore diets. It is a processed sweet food and contains gluten, eggs, and dairy.
